首页 > 数据库 > mysql教程 > 尽管 PHPMyAdmin 显示连接成功,为什么我的 PHP PDO 代码出现'未知数据库错误”?

尽管 PHPMyAdmin 显示连接成功,为什么我的 PHP PDO 代码出现'未知数据库错误”?

Linda Hamilton
发布: 2024-12-17 18:08:14
原创
624 人浏览过

Why Does My PHP PDO Code Get an

数据库连接问题:尽管在 PHPMyAdmin 中建立连接,仍出现未知错误

使用 PHP 中的 PDO 库连接到 MySQL 数据库时,用户尝试访问新创建的数据库时遇到“未知数据库错误”。尽管成功连接到 PHPMyAdmin 中预先存在的数据库,此问题仍然存在。

要解决此问题,考虑两个潜在原因至关重要:

  1. 拼写错误:仔细检查 PHP 代码中指定的数据库名称与 PHPMyAdmin 中创建的实际名称。任何拼写差异都可能导致连接失败。
  2. 不同的数据库连接:PHPMyAdmin 和 PHP 脚本可能连接到不同的数据库服务器。要验证这一点,请在 PHPMyAdmin 和 PHP 中执行以下查询:

    SHOW DATABASES;
    登录后复制

    比较输出。如果数据库名称不一致,则表明 PHPMyAdmin 和 PHP 连接到不同的服务器。

如果 PHPMyAdmin 和 PHP 确实连接到不同的服务器,则 PHP 配置文件可以修改为指定正确的服务器连接信息。通过解决这些潜在原因,PHP 代码应该能够与新创建的数据库建立连接,而不会遇到“未知数据库错误”。

以上是尽管 PHPMyAdmin 显示连接成功,为什么我的 PHP PDO 代码出现'未知数据库错误”?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板